+Note: that if you're using [nvim-metals](https://github.com/scalameta/nvim-metals), that plugin fully handles the setup and installation of Metals, and you shouldn't set up Metals both with it and this plugin.
+
+To install Metals, make sure to have [coursier](https://get-coursier.io/docs/cli-installation) installed, and once you do you can install the latest Metals with `cs install metals`. You can also manually bootstrap Metals with the following command.
+
+```bash
+cs bootstrap \
+ --java-opt -Xss4m \
+ --java-opt -Xms100m \
+ org.scalameta:metals_2.12:<enter-version-here> \
+ -r bintray:scalacenter/releases \
+ -r sonatype:snapshots \
+ -o /usr/local/bin/metals -f
+```
